4 MPC assumes responsibilities and risks for integrating & disseminating microdata and metadata (as CCSR for UK) » Uniform Memorandum of Understanding » Founding partners (2001): France, Spain, China, Vietnam, Kenya, Colombia, Mexico, USA … now 97 countries …including UK (2004) » Specifies conditions for entrusting microdata and for access » Uniform license agreement: transparent, democratic access for qualified researchers and students » Over 4,500 registered researchers in 90+ countries » Hundreds of publications (click http://bibliography.ipums.org & select IPUMS-International) http://bibliography.ipums.org » NSOsmany formerly paralyzed by fearare relieved to be freed of risks, responsibilities, and the work! 4

27 Vital registration data: among births to Arab parents in Michigan, prenatal exposure to Ramada fasting Vital registration data: among births to Arab parents in Michigan, prenatal exposure to Ramada fasting lower birth weight lower birth weight first month of gestation, fewer male births first month of gestation, fewer male births IPUMS-International census samples, Uganda 02 (n = 80k Muslims), Iraq 97 (250k) --disability, religion, month of birth. Long term fetal origins effect, where early pregnancy overlapped with Ramadan: IPUMS-International census samples, Uganda 02 (n = 80k Muslims), Iraq 97 (250k) --disability, religion, month of birth. Long term fetal origins effect, where early pregnancy overlapped with Ramadan: adults 20% more likely to be disabled adults 20% more likely to be disabled effects are larger for mental (learning) disabilities effects are larger for mental (learning) disabilities relatively mild prenatal exposures can have persistent effects relatively mild prenatal exposures can have persistent effects maternal behavior, particularly during the first month of pregnancy, can have permanent impacts on offspring health maternal behavior, particularly during the first month of pregnancy, can have permanent impacts on offspring health Impact: Ramadan fasting and fetal health D. Almond & B. Mazumder Health Capital and the Prenatal Environment: The Effect of Ramadan Observance During Pregnancy American Economic Journal (2011)
